U+0A94 "ઔ" Gujarati Letter Au is the fourteenth vowel in the Gujarati abugida, representing the diphthong sound /əu/ as in the English word "cow" or in the Gujarati word "ઔષધ" (aushadh, meaning medicine). It is formed by combining the vowel sign "ઔ" with a consonant, and it appears as a distinct character in written Gujarati, primarily used in vocabulary derived from Sanskrit and in transliterations of foreign words. In the Unicode standard, this character falls within the Gujarati script block and is encoded for digital text processing to ensure proper representation and rendering of the language in modern computing systems.
